Peonies in a Bowl and a Teapot
But, peonies are now in bloom. The season is from May to June. You can get them as cut flowers at other times of the year, but this is when the prices go down and you can get them locally for a bit less.
Peonies are not cheap, but they are worth every scent cent!
Peony Centerpieces
Some varieties of peonies are fragrant. Some are not. If you are planning to use this many peonies in a room where people will be eating, you may want to opt for an unscented variety.
White Peonies In A Mixed Flower Arrangement
Peonies work well with other flowers in a flower arrangement. But don't cram them too tightly in a vase, because the blooms are huge and need room to open.
I love peonies used alone in a bouquet or an flower arrangement. Roses, lisianthus and even hydrangea look great with them especially when they are of similar colors.
Peonies In A Glass
Peonies are so large headed you could place one stem in a glass and line a group of them down the center of your table for a simple yet elegant centerpiece. But don't just save them for special occasions.
